

If the phone works properly and does not request an unlock code, it's already unlocked. (Carefully insert the SIM card tray key in the slot until the tray pops out, then switch SIM cards and replace the tray). You can test your phone to see if it's locked by removing the SIM card and replacing it with one from another carrier. If you have any recurring payments on your Galaxy S10, it is almost certainly locked. Most carriers only sell unlocked phones for the full purchase price. Verizon no longer locks its phones, so if you have a Verizon model, you can remove the Verizon SIM card and replace it with one from another carrier.
